Compared by dimension

On an average Switzerland income of €86,400 gross per year, you keep €64,007 net in India: a difference of €6,711 per year compared with Switzerland.

  • Tax: on this income India lands at an effective rate of about 26%, against 18% in Switzerland.
  • Passport and mobility: from India you travel visa-free to 62 countries.
  • Residency: on our accessibility scale India scores 34 out of 100 for obtaining residency.
  • Living environment: banking, internet, safety and healthcare together give India a living-environment score of 50 out of 100.
